*Update-Suspect Identified and Arrested* Delaware State Police Investigating Convenience Store Robbery- Dover


Date Posted: Saturday, June 5th, 2021

Dover, DE- Delaware State Police arrested John L. Walstrum, 29, of Dover, for a convenience store robbery that occurred Wednesday afternoon. 

On June 2, 2021, at approximately 3:25 p.m., Walstrum entered the Wawa convenience store located at 1525 E. Lebanon Road, Dover. Once at the check-out counter, the suspect demanded money from the female cashier. The cashier complied and handed over an undisclosed amount of money before the suspect fled out the front door of the business. No one was injured during the incident. Through investigative leads, John L. Walstrum was identified as the suspect wanted in connection to this robbery. On June 4, 2021, Delaware State Police Detectives arrested Walstrum for the WAWA robbery, and he was charged with Robbery 2nd Degree (Felony). Walstrum was arraigned in the Justice of the Peace Court #2 and released on his own recognizance.
